Post on 01-Jun-2020
MCSD Web Developer & App Builder
All Rights reserved @ www.clslearn.com , Contact us : register@clslearn.com , +201000216660 , +201001692348
Learning Path Overview
MCSD Web Developer & App Builder Duration:160 Hours
Schedule :Full Day Morning ( 9-5)
Half Day Evening (6-10)
Weekends Full Day (10-4)
Instructor-Led
Hands-On Training
Delivery Options:
In CLS Classroom.
On site Classroom.
Online Live.
Your Training Comes with
a 100% Satisfaction
Guarantee!
This certification validates that you have the skills needed to build modern mobile and/or web applications and services.The Microsoft Certified Solutions Developer (MCSD) App Builder certification validates that you have the skills needed to build modern mobile and/or web applications and services. Earning an MCSD: App Builder certification qualifies you for a position as an application developer.
Course Included:
1- Programming in C# 40 Hours2- Programming in HTML5, JavaScript & CSS3 40 Hours3- Developing ASP.NET Core MVC Web Applications 40 Hours4- Developing Microsoft Azure & Web Services 40 Hours
All Rights reserved @ www.clslearn.com , Contact us : register@clslearn.com , +201000216660 , +201001692348
Learning Path Outline
All Rights reserved @ www.clslearn.com , Contact us : register@clslearn.com , +201000216660 , +201001692348
Programming in C# 40 HoursModule 1: Review of Visual C# Syntax
Module 2: Creating Methods, Handling
Exceptions, and Monitoring Applications
Module 3: Basic types and constructs of
Visual C#
Module 4: Creating Classes and
Implementing Type-Safe Collections
Module 5: Creating a Class Hierarchy by
Using Inheritance
Module 6: Reading and Writing Local Data
Module 7: Accessing a Database
Module 8: Accessing Remote Data
Module 9: Designing the User Interface for
a Graphical Application
Module 10: Improving Application
Performance and Responsiveness
Module 11: Integrating with Unmanaged
Code
Module 12: Creating Reusable Types and
Assemblies
Module 13: Encrypting and Decrypting
Data
Programming in HTML5, JavaScript & CSS3 40 HoursModule 1: Overview of HTML and CSS
Module 2: Creating and Styling HTML Pages
Module 3: Introduction to JavaScript
Module 4: Creating Forms to Collect and
Validate User Input
Module 5: Communicating with a Remote
Server
Module 6: Styling HTML5 by Using CSS3
Module 7: Creating Objects and Methods
by Using JavaScript
Module 8: Creating Interactive Pages by
Using HTML5 APIs
Module 9: Adding Offline Support to Web
Applications
Module 10: Implementing an Adaptive User
Interface
Module 11: Creating Advanced Graphics
Module 12: Animating the User Interface
Developing ASP.NET Core MVC Web
Applications 40 HoursModule 1: Exploring ASP.NET Core MVC
Module 2: Designing ASP.NET Core MVC
Web Applications
Module 3: Configure Middle wares and
Services in ASP.NET Core
Module 4: Developing Controller
Module 5: Developing Views
Module 6: Developing Models
Module 7: Using Entity Framework Core in
ASP.NET Core
Module 8: Using Layouts, CSS and
JavaScript in ASP.NET Core MVC
Module 9: Client-Side Development
Module 10: Testing and Troubleshooting
Module 11: Managing Security
Module 12: Performance and
Communication
Module 13: Implementing Web APIs
Module 14: Hosting and Deployment
Developing Microsoft Azure & Web Services 40 HoursModule 1: Overview of service and cloud
technologies
Module 2: Querying and Manipulating
Data Using Entity Framework
Module 3: Creating and Consuming
ASP.NET Core Web APIs
Module 4: Extending ASP.NET Core HTTP
Services
Module 5: Hosting Services On-Premises
and in Azure
Module 6: Deploying and Managing
Services
Module 7: Implementing Data Storage in
Azure
Module 8: Diagnostics and Monitoring
Module 9: Securing services on-premises
and in Microsoft Azure
Module 10: Scaling Services
Learning Path Outcome Audience Profile
* Describe the core syntax and features of Visual C#.* Create methods, handle exceptions, and describe the monitoring requirements of large-scale applications.* Implement the basic structure and essential elements of a typical desktop application.* Create classes, define and implement interfaces, and create and use generic collections.* Explain how to use Visual Studio 2017 to create and run a Web application.* Describe the new features of HTML5, and create and style HTML5 pages.* Add interactivity to an HTML5 page by using JavaScript.* Create HTML5 forms by using different input types, and validate user input by using HTML5 attributes and JavaScript code* Describe the Microsoft Web Technologies stack and select an appropriate technology to use to develop any given application.* Design the architecture and implementation of a web application that will meet a set of functional requirements, user interface requirements, and address business models* Describe the basic concepts of service development and data access strategies using the .NET platform.* Describe the Microsoft Azure cloud platform and its compute, data, and application hosting offerings.
- This course is intended for experienced developers who already have programming experience in C, C++, JavaScript, Objective-C, Microsoft Visual Basic, or Java and understand the concepts of object-oriented programming- This course is intended for professional developers who have 6-12 months of programming experience and who are interested in developing applications using HTML5 with JavaScript and CSS3 (either Windows Store apps for Windows 10 or web applications).- Candidates for this course are interested in developing advanced web applications and want to manage the rendered HTML comprehensively.- Primary: .NET developers who want to learn how to develop services and deploy them to hybrid environments.
Prerequisites
- Developers attending this course should already have gained
some limited experience using C# to complete basic programming
tasks.
- 1 month of experience using Visual Studio 2017
- Before attending this course, students must complete the
following courses:- 20480C Programming in HTML5 with JavaScript and CSS3
- 20483C: Programming in C#
Before attending this course, students must have completed the
following courses:
- 20480C Programming in HTML5 with JavaScript and CSS3
- 20483C: Programming in C#
- 20486D: Developing ASP.NET Core MVC Web Applications
All Rights reserved @ www.clslearn.com , Contact us : register@clslearn.com , +201000216660 , +201001692348
We select the best instructors, who are certified from trustworthy
international vendors. They don’t only provide training program, but they
also share their professional experience with the students, so they can have
hands-on experience on the job market.
CLS facilities are well-equipped with strong hardware and software
technologies that aid both students and trainers lead very effective
smooth training programs.
We provide our clients with the best solutions, Our team of training advisers
answer whatever questions you have.
We have been in the market since 1995, and we kept accumulating
experience in the training business, and providing training for more than
100,000 trainees ever since, in Egypt, and the MENA region.
CLS is an authorized and accredited partner by technology leaders like
Microsoft, EC-Council, Adobe and Autodesk. This means that our
training programs are of the highest quality source materials, the most
up-to-date, and have the highest return on investment ever possible.
We keep tabs on every change in the market and the technology field,
so our training programs will always be updated up to the World-class
latest standards, and adapted to the global shape-shifting job market.
Our clients prefer our training programs not only for the quality
education they get, but also because they are cost effective.
All Rights reserved @ www.clslearn.com , Contact us : register@clslearn.com , +201000216660 , +201001692348